DEFINITION

What is Isobutanol?

Isobutanol is a renewable alcohol fuel (C₄H₁₀O) that blends into gasoline and marine fuels, offering higher energy density than ethanol and a drop-in path for some engines.

Isobutanol vs ethanol: which to choose?

Isobutanol offers higher energy density and better blend compatibility than ethanol for some uses.
